Erosion

Independent documentary that addresses the different environmental problems in the north of Quintana Roo -located in the Mexican Caribbean - caused by the rapid tourism development and uncontrolled population growth.

Mining, sewage discharges into the sea and groundwater, erosion of beaches, excessive logging, damage to the habitat of protected species such as the jaguar, puma, and sea turtles, devastation of mangrove, coastal dune and cenotes (sink holes), illegal constructions, the lessening of historical heritage, poor city planning and little rigour of the authorities of the three levels of government to implement the norms, have made the Mexican Caribbean a time bomb whose detonation anticipates a desolating end.
